[PATCH] nfs: don't pass non-NULL-terminated string to pr_notice()

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



There is no guarantee that the strings in the nfs_cache_array will be
NULL-terminated. In the event that we end up hitting a readdir loop, we
need to ensure that we pass the warning message a properly-terminated
string.

diff --git a/fs/nfs/dir.c b/fs/nfs/dir.c
index 5c0b6ecc3a88..4689b125f9fe 100644
--- a/fs/nfs/dir.c
+++ b/fs/nfs/dir.c
@@ -304,12 +304,13 @@ int nfs_readdir_search_for_cookie(struct nfs_cache_array *array, nfs_readdir_des
 				if (ctx->duped > 0
 				    && ctx->dup_cookie == *desc->dir_cookie) {
 					if (printk_ratelimit()) {
+						char *name = kstrndup(array->array[i].string.name, array->array[i].string.len, GFP_KERNEL);
+
 						pr_notice("NFS: directory %pD2 contains a readdir loop."
 								"Please contact your server vendor.  "
 								"The file: %s has duplicate cookie %llu\n",
-								desc->file,
-								array->array[i].string.name,
-								*desc->dir_cookie);
+								desc->file, name, *desc->dir_cookie);
+						kfree(name);
 					}
 					status = -ELOOP;
 					goto out;
